Bambusa Arundinacea Juice

Extracted from the giant thorny bamboo, this nutrient-dense liquid serves as a bio-available source of silica and essential minerals. This botanical sap provides immediate humectant benefits while supporting the long-term structural integrity of the skin barrier.

INCI Name:
Bambusa Arundinacea Juice
Chemical/Scientific Name:
Bambusa Arundinacea Juice
Common Aliases:
Bamboo Juice, Bamboo Sap, Giant Thorny Bamboo Water
Category: Active Substances
Source Origin: Plant-based (Bamboo)
Comedogenic Rating: 0
Primary Industries: Skincare, Personal Care
Solubility: Water-soluble

Primary Benefits:

  • Delivers bio-available organic silica to support collagen synthesis.
  • Provides deep humectant hydration comparable to Glycerin.
  • Calms reactive skin through a high concentration of phenolic compounds.
  • Replenishes essential minerals including potassium and magnesium.

Potential Risks:

  • Very low risk of contact dermatitis in individuals with specific grass allergies.
  • Susceptibility to microbial contamination if the formula lacks robust preservation.

Biological Action & Cosmetic Profile

Natural silica concentrations found within this botanical sap distinguish it from standard floral waters. Silica is a foundational trace element required for the hydroxylation of enzymes that link collagen fibers, theoretically improving the elasticity and tensile strength of the dermis. Unlike synthetic silicas used for texture, the organic silica in this juice is highly compatible with the skin’s biological processes.

Humectant properties are driven by a complex profile of amino acids and saccharides. These molecules mirror the skin’s Natural Moisturizing Factor (NMF), allowing the juice to bind water within the stratum corneum. When applied topically, these solutes prevent trans-epidermal water loss (TEWL) and maintain the osmotic balance of epidermal cells.

Antioxidant activity is facilitated by the presence of flavones and phenolic acids. These compounds neutralize reactive oxygen species (ROS) generated by UV exposure and environmental pollutants. By mitigating oxidative stress, the juice assists in preventing the premature degradation of the extracellular matrix, making it a functional additive for urban defense formulations.

Broader Applications & Origins

Native to Southeast Asia, the Bambusa arundinacea species has been utilized for centuries in traditional Ayurvedic practices for its cooling and restorative properties. In modern cosmetics, the juice is obtained by tapping the living bamboo stalks during peak growth cycles to ensure maximum nutrient density. This sustainable harvesting method yields a liquid far more complex than simple bamboo distillates or powders.

Routine Integration

Synergies:

  • Sodium Hyaluronate: Enhances multi-level hydration and plumping effects.
  • Panthenol: Accelerates barrier repair and reduces inflammation.
  • Niacinamide: Works alongside bamboo-derived minerals to improve skin tone and texture.
  • Allantoin: Boosts the soothing profile for extremely sensitive skin types.

Conflicts:

  • No known chemical conflicts; universally compatible with most active ingredients.

Clinical Consensus & Safety

Dermatological assessments categorize this botanical juice as a non-irritating and non-sensitizing ingredient suitable for all skin types, including sensitive and acne-prone skin. The Cosmetic Ingredient Review (CIR) Expert Panel and CosIng database recognize bamboo-derived extracts as safe for use in cosmetic concentrations. Because it is a water-based botanical, clinical efficacy is most frequently noted in studies regarding skin hydration and antioxidant protection, though it is often used as a secondary active to support more potent ingredients like Aloe Barbadensis Leaf Juice.

Is Bambusa Arundinacea Juice better for skin than plain water?

Yes. While plain water provides temporary surface moisture, this juice contains minerals, silica, and amino acids that provide functional benefits, including antioxidant protection and structural support, which distilled water lacks.

Can this ingredient cause breakouts?

No. It has a comedogenic rating of 0. The high silica content can actually provide a slight matting effect, making it particularly beneficial for individuals with oily or combination skin.

Does it replace the need for a moisturizer?

Generally, no. It functions as a humectant and active liquid. While it deeply hydrates, it should be followed by an occlusive or emollient to seal in the moisture and prevent evaporation.
